    "Nowhere to Run" is a 1965 song by Martha and the Vandellas for the Gordy label and is one of the group's signature songs. The song, written and produced by Motown's main production team of Holland–Dozier–Holland , depicts the story of a woman trapped in a bad relationship with a man she cannot help but love.

    Two Years' Vacation. Two Years' Vacation ( French: Deux ans de vacances) is an adventure novel by Jules Verne, published in 1888. The story tells of the fortunes of a group of schoolboys stranded on a deserted island in the South Pacific, and of their struggles to overcome adversity.     Clinton is the first woman in U.S. history to be nominated for president of the United States by a major political party. She was defeated in the 2016 general election by Republican Donald Trump . The 2016 presidential campaign of Hillary Clinton was announced in a YouTube video on April 12, 2015.     In 1969, the album was reissued by Liberty (having discontinued the Dolton label two years earlier but keeping the original stereo catalog number), featuring an updated photo of the group. By that time, the lineup consisted of Don Wilson, Bob Bogle, Gerry McGee, Mel Taylor and John Durrill, though only the former two appear on the album.
